I have a very nice R-388. The radio is pretty sensitive and very stable
after only a few minutes, unlike the Hammarlunds which drift for hours.
It's also quite accurate for the day. You can dial a station right to the
KHz and it'll be there. You can also, as Peter Maus warned me a long time
ago, develop a strong right arm cranking that band change knob.
